{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,6]],"date-time":"2024-09-06T22:59:15Z","timestamp":1725663555930},"publisher-location":"Berlin, Heidelberg","reference-count":15,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540510857"},{"type":"electronic","value":"9783540461555"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[1989]]},"DOI":"10.1007\/3-540-51085-0_47","type":"book-chapter","created":{"date-parts":[[2012,2,25]],"date-time":"2012-02-25T20:44:46Z","timestamp":1330202686000},"page":"175-199","source":"Crossref","is-referenced-by-count":2,"title":["Altruistic locking: A strategy for coping with long lived transactions"],"prefix":"10.1007","author":[{"given":"Kenneth","family":"Salem","sequence":"first","affiliation":[]},{"given":"Hector","family":"Garcia-Molina","sequence":"additional","affiliation":[]},{"given":"Rafael","family":"Alonso","sequence":"additional","affiliation":[]}],"member":"297","published-online":{"date-parts":[[2005,5,31]]},"reference":[{"key":"8_CR1","doi-asserted-by":"crossref","unstructured":"Ahuja, Mohan L. and J. C. Brown, \u201cConcurrency Control by Pre-Ordering Entities in Databases with Multi-Versioned Entities,\u201d Proc. Int'l Conf. on Data Engineering, pp. 312\u2013321, Los Angeles, CA, February, 1987.","DOI":"10.1109\/ICDE.1987.7272396"},{"issue":"2","key":"8_CR2","doi-asserted-by":"publisher","first-page":"97","DOI":"10.1145\/320455.320457","volume":"1","author":"M. M. Astrahan","year":"1976","unstructured":"et al, Astrahan, M. M., \u201cSystem R: A Relational Approach to Database Management,\u201d ACM Transactions on Database Systems, vol. 1, no. 2, pp. 97\u2013137, June, 1976.","journal-title":"ACM Transactions on Database Systems"},{"key":"8_CR3","doi-asserted-by":"crossref","unstructured":"Bayer, Rudolf, \u201cConsistency of Transactions and Random Batch,\u201d ACM Transactions on Database Systems, Jan., 1987.","DOI":"10.1145\/7239.214287"},{"issue":"1","key":"8_CR4","doi-asserted-by":"publisher","first-page":"18","DOI":"10.1145\/320128.320131","volume":"5","author":"Philip A. A. Bernstein","year":"1980","unstructured":"Bernstein, Philip A., David W. Shipman, and James B. Rothnie, Jr., \u201cConcurrency Control in a System for Distributed Databases (SDD-1),\u201d ACM Transactions on Database Systems, vol. 5, no. 1, pp. 18\u201351, March, 1980.","journal-title":"ACM Transactions on Database Systems"},{"issue":"2","key":"8_CR5","doi-asserted-by":"publisher","first-page":"186","DOI":"10.1145\/319983.319985","volume":"8","author":"H. Garcia-Molina","year":"1983","unstructured":"Garcia-Molina, Hector, \u201cUsing Semantic Knowledge for Transaction Processing in a Distributed Database,\u201d ACM Transactions on Database Systems, vol. 8, no. 2, pp. 186\u2013213, June 1983.","journal-title":"ACM Transactions on Database Systems"},{"key":"8_CR6","doi-asserted-by":"crossref","unstructured":"Garcia-Molina, Hector and Kenneth Salem, \u201cSagas,\u201d Proc. ACM SIGMOD Annual Conference, pp. 249\u2013259, San Francisco, CA, May, 1987.","DOI":"10.1145\/38713.38742"},{"key":"8_CR7","unstructured":"Gifford, David K. and James E. Donahue, \u201cCoordinating Independent Atomic Actions,\u201d Proceedings of IEEE COMPCON, San Francisco, CA, February, 1985."},{"key":"8_CR8","doi-asserted-by":"crossref","unstructured":"Gray, Jim, \u201cNotes on Data Base Operating Systems,\u201d in Operating Systems: An Advanced Course, ed. G. Seegm\u00fcller, pp. 393\u2013481, Springer-Verlag, 1978.","DOI":"10.1007\/3-540-08755-9_9"},{"key":"8_CR9","first-page":"144","volume-title":"The Transaction Concept: Virtues and Limitations","author":"J. Gray","year":"1981","unstructured":"Gray, Jim, \u201cThe Transaction Concept: Virtues and Limitations,\u201d Proceedings of the Seventh Int'l. Conference on Very Large Databases, pp. 144\u2013154, IEEE, Cannes, France, Sept., 1981."},{"key":"8_CR10","doi-asserted-by":"crossref","unstructured":"Gray, J. N., R. A. Lorie, G. R. Putzolu, and I. L. Traiger, \u201cGranularity of Locks and Degrees of Consistency in a Shared Data Base,\u201d in Modeling in Data Base Management Systems, ed. G. M. Nijssen, pp. 365\u2013394, North Holland Publishing Company, 1976.","DOI":"10.1145\/1282480.1282513"},{"key":"8_CR11","first-page":"309","volume-title":"Non-Two-Phase Locking Protocols With Shared and Exclusive Locks","author":"Z. Kedem","year":"1980","unstructured":"Kedem, Zvi and Abraham Silberschatz, \u201cNon-Two-Phase Locking Protocols With Shared and Exclusive Locks,\u201d Proceedings of the Conference on Very Large Databases, pp. 309\u2013317, IEEE, Montreal, Canada, Oct., 1980."},{"key":"8_CR12","volume-title":"A New Locking Protocol that Achieves All Serializable Executions","author":"S. Lafortune","year":"1984","unstructured":"Lafortune, S. and E. Wong, \u201cA New Locking Protocol that Achieves All Serializable Executions,\u201d Memorandum No. UCB\/ERL M84\/77, Elec. Research Lab., Univ. of California, Berkeley, CA, September, 1984."},{"key":"8_CR13","volume-title":"Crash Recovery in a Distributed Data Storage System","author":"Butler W. W. Lampson","year":"1979","unstructured":"Lampson, Butler W. and Howard E. Sturgis, Crash Recovery in a Distributed Data Storage System, Xerox Palo Alto Research Center, Palo Alto, California, April, 1979."},{"issue":"4","key":"8_CR14","doi-asserted-by":"publisher","first-page":"484","DOI":"10.1145\/319996.319999","volume":"8","author":"N. Lynch","year":"1983","unstructured":"Lynch, Nancy, \u201cMultilevel Atomicity \u2014 A New Correctness Criterion for Database Concurrency Control,\u201d ACM Transactions on Database Systems, vol. 8, no. 4, pp. 484\u2013502, December, 1983.","journal-title":"ACM Transactions on Database Systems"},{"key":"8_CR15","unstructured":"Salem, K. and H. Garcia-Molina, \u201cThe Correctness of Two Locking Protocols for Long-Lived Transactions,\u201d unpublished report, Dept. of Computer Science, Princeton University, July, 1987."}],"container-title":["Lecture Notes in Computer Science","High Performance Transaction Systems"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/3-540-51085-0_47.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,12,31]],"date-time":"2021-12-31T02:47:25Z","timestamp":1640918845000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/3-540-51085-0_47"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1989]]},"ISBN":["9783540510857","9783540461555"],"references-count":15,"URL":"https:\/\/doi.org\/10.1007\/3-540-51085-0_47","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[1989]]}}}